Understanding the Role of Personal Injury Attorneys
Personal injury attorneys are legal professionals who specialize in providing legal representation to individuals who have been physically or psychologically injured due to the negligence or wrongdoing of another party. Their primary objective is to protect the rights of the injured and help them seek compensation for their losses. Here’s a glimpse of their role:
Case Evaluation: Personal injury attorneys assess the viability of your case by gathering evidence, reviewing medical records, and consulting experts if necessary. They determine the strength of your claim and advise you on the potential legal options available.
Legal Advocacy: Attorneys act as your advocates, representing your best interests in negotiations, settlements, or courtroom proceedings. They handle all legal aspects of your case, including paperwork, legal research, and communication with insurance companies or opposing parties.
Compensation Maximization: Personal injury attorneys strive to obtain the maximum compensation possible for your injuries and losses. They evaluate the full extent of your damages, which may include med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and future rehabilitation costs, and fight for fair and just compensation.
Types of Cases Handled by Personal Injury Attorneys
Personal injury attorneys handle a wide range of cases, each requiring specific expertise and knowledge. Some common types of cases they handle include:
Car Accidents: Car accidents are one of the leading causes of personal injury cases. Attorneys help victims of car accidents seek compensation for injuries and property damage, working to prove negligence on the part of the responsible driver.
Slip and Fall Accidents: Personal injury attorneys assist individuals who have been injured in slip and fall accidents caused by hazardous conditions on someone else’s property. They investigate the circumstances, establish liability, and pursue compensation for medical bills, lost wages, and other damages.
Medical Malpractice: When medical professionals fail to provide the standard of care expected, resulting in injury or wrongful death, personal injury attorneys can help victims or their families seek justice. These cases require extensive knowledge of medical standards and the ability to navigate complex legal processes.
Product Liability: If you’ve suffered injuries due to a defective product, personal injury attorneys can hold the manufacturer or distributor accountable. They handle product liability cases, aiming to secure compensation for injuries caused by faulty design, manufacturing defects, or inadequate warnings.

Choosing the Right Personal Injury Attorney
Selecting the right personal injury attorney is crucial for the success of your case. Here are some key considerations when making your choice:
Experience and Expertise: Look for an attorney who specializes in personal injury law and has a proven track record of handling cases similar to yours. Consider their years of experience, success rate, and reputation within the legal community.
Resources and Support: Ensure that the attorney has access to the necessary resources to build a strong case, including expert witnesses, investigators, and medical professionals. Additionally, inquire about the support staff in their office who will assist in the preparation of your case.
Communication and Personal Attention: Choose an attorney who values clear and open communication. They should be accessible, responsive to your queries, and keep you informed about the progress of your case. Personal attention and empathy are essential qualities that foster a strong attorney-client relationship.
Client Reviews and Testimonials: Read reviews and testimonials from previous clients to gain insight into their experiences working with the attorney. Pay attention to feedback regarding communication, professionalism, and the outcome of their cases.
Fee Structure: Discuss the attorney’s fee structure during the initial consultation. Most personal injury attorneys work on a contingency fee basis, meaning they only receive a payment if they win your case. Clarify the percentage they will take as a contingency fee and any additional costs you may be responsible for.
